CVE-2024-55953 Dataease Mysql JDBC Connection Parameters Not Verified Leads to Deserialization and Arbitrary File Read Vulnerability

CVE-2024-55953 in DataEase allows deserialization and file read via unverified JDBC parameters. Upgrade needed.
